1. Our Commitment
frame:work is committed to creating a professional community that is welcoming, inclusive, and free from harassment. We believe respectful collaboration is essential to advancing creative and technical practice in the creative video industry.This Code of Conduct applies to all participants in frame:work activities, including members, speakers, sponsors, partners, volunteers, staff, and guests.
2. Scope
This Code of Conduct applies to all frame:work spaces and activities, including but not limited to:
- In-person events, conferences, workshops, and social gatherings;
- Online events, forums, and meetings;
- Community platforms (e.g., website, Discord, Slack, email lists, livestream chats);
- One-on-one interactions that occur within the context of frame:work activities.
3. Expected Behavior
All participants are expected to:
- Treat others with respect and professionalism;
- Communicate thoughtfully across differences of background, experience, and perspective;
- Be mindful of how words, actions, and behavior affect others;
- Respect physical, personal, and professional boundaries;
- Support a culture of learning, curiosity, and constructive dialogue;
Community leaders, moderators, speakers, and organizers are held to the same standards as all participants.
4. Unacceptable Behavior
Harassment is not tolerated in any form.
Harassment includes, but is not limited to:
- Offensive verbal or written comments related to:
Gender, gender identity or expression
Age
Sexual orientation
Disability
Physical appearance or body size
Race, ethnicity, nationality
Religion
Technology choices or professional background - Sexual images or content in public or shared spaces without consent;
- Deliberate intimidation, threats, stalking, or following;
- Harassing photography, recording, or screenshots;
- Sustained disruption of talks, discussions, or events;
- Inappropriate physical contact;
- Unwelcome sexual attention or advances;
- Any other conduct that a reasonable person would consider inappropriate, unsafe, or disruptive to the community environment.
Participants asked to stop any harassing or disruptive behavior must comply immediately. Failure to comply may result in immediate removal or termination.
5. Reporting Concerns
If you experience harassment, witness harassment, or have concerns about behavior within the frame:work community, we encourage you to report it as soon as possible.
Reports may be made to:
- A frame:work director
- Any member of the frame:work board of directors
- An event organizer or staff member
Contact information for founders and community leaders is available on the frame:work website or through official event communications. Reports will be handled with discretion and care. While anonymity cannot always be guaranteed, frame:work will make reasonable efforts to protect the privacy of those involved. frame:work is not obligated to conduct a formal investigation or disclose the outcome of any report.
6. Response and Enforcement
frame:work reserves the right, in its sole discretion, to take any action it deems appropriate, with or without prior notice including, but not limited to:
- Verbal or written warnings;
- Temporary suspension from community spaces or events;
- Removal from an event without refund;
- Termination of membership;
- Exclusion from future frame:work activities;
7. Safety and Support at In-Person Events
At in-person events, frame:work organizers and moderators will assist participants who feel unsafe by:
- Helping contact venue security or local authorities when appropriate
- Providing support or accompaniment within the event environment
- Taking reasonable steps to address immediate safety concerns
Participants are expected to follow this Code of Conduct at all event venues and at event-related social activities. This Code of Conduct may also apply to behavior occurring outside of frame:work activities where such behavior negatively impacts the safety, integrity, or reputation of the frame:work community.
8. Retaliation
Retaliation against individuals who report concerns or participate in an investigation is not tolerated and may result in disciplinary action.
